FANToM: A Benchmark for Stress-testing Machine Theory of Mind in Interactions (2023.emnlp-main)

| Challenge: | Existing evaluations for theory of mind (ToM) use passive narratives that lack interactivity. |
| Approach: | They propose a benchmark to stress-test ToM within information-asymmetric conversational contexts via question answering. |
| Outcome: | The proposed benchmark is challenging for state-of-the-art language models, which perform significantly worse than humans even with chain-of thought reasoning or fine-tuning. |

SODA: Million-scale Dialogue Distillation with Social Commonsense Contextualization (2023.emnlp-main)

| Challenge: | a dataset of 1.5 million conversations distilled from everyday spoken situations is limited in scale due to its associated costs. |
| Approach: | They propose to make SODA a publicly available, million-scale high-quality social dialogue dataset . they contextualize social commonsense knowledge from a knowledge graph to distill broad spectrum of social interactions . |
| Outcome: | The proposed dataset is the first publicly available, million-scale high-quality social dialogue dataset. |
